Задать вопрос
@Cosmicmidget

DAX \ Power BI как сделать меру через промежуточную таблицу?

Есть 3 таблицы(b_crm_deal, b_uts_crm_deal, doc_Sales) данных которые связаны между собой последовательно через связи:
b_crm_deal - ID = b_uts_crm_deal - VALUE
и
b_uts_crm_deal - № ЗК = doc_Sales- Number

713fbb3e31fdf485cc4efaaabfcdb783.png

Я пытаюсь построить визуализацю в power bi, вида

a7887cc4b15f618173bbecf7c897ef9e.png

b_crm_deal.Ответственный для прогноза, сумма(b_crm_deal.ПЛАН), сумма(doc_Sales.Amount)

Но сумма факта из таблицы doc_Sales подтягивается только на уровне итога. Как заставить меру разбиваться по менеджерам?
  • Вопрос задан
  • 10 просмотров
Подписаться 1 Средний Комментировать
Помогут разобраться в теме Все курсы
  • Нетология
    Data Scientist: расширенный курс
    20 месяцев
    Далее
  • Яндекс Практикум
    Аналитик данных
    7 месяцев
    Далее
  • Skillbox
    Профессия Data-аналитик
    12 месяцев
    Далее
Пригласить эксперта
Ответы на вопрос 1
opium
@opium
Просто люблю качественно работать
фильтр от Ответственного не пробивается через промежуточную таблицу до doc_Sales — по дефолту связи однонаправленные. Добавь CROSSFILTER в меру:

ФАКТ = CALCULATE(
    SUM(doc_Sales[Amount]),
    CROSSFILTER(b_crm_deal[ID], b_uts_crm_deal[VALUE], Both),
    CROSSFILTER(b_uts_crm_deal[№ ЗК], doc_Sales[Number], Both)
)


или в модели тыкни на связи и поставь направление "Оба", но это мб сломает другие визуалы.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ы